Life expectancy ranking 1961 — the top 20 economies
The twenty largest economies by Life Expectancy at Birth in 1961, ranked by the exact World Bank figures. The leader: Netherlands (73.65). A total of 216 economies reported a value that year.
| # | Country | years (1961) |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| Netherlands | 73.65 |
| 2 | Norway | 73.55 |
| 3 | Iceland | 73.5 |
| 4 | Sweden | 73.47 |
| 5 | San Marino | 73.38 |
| 6 | Faroe Islands | 72.71 |
| 7 | Andorra | 72.57 |
| 8 | Denmark | 72.44 |
| 9 | Monaco | 72.18 |
| 10 | Israel | 72.01 |
| 11 | Switzerland | 71.64 |
| 12 | Channel Islands | 71.6 |
| 13 | Canada | 71.35 |
| 14 | New Zealand | 70.99 |
| 15 | Australia | 70.97 |
| 16 | Liechtenstein | 70.96 |
| 17 | United Kingdom | 70.88 |
| 18 | Slovak Republic | 70.72 |
| 19 | Belgium | 70.52 |
| 20 | Czechia | 70.51 |
